2016-07-28 9 views
0

私はNebula NatTableを自分のプロジェクトで使ってきましたが、基本はよく知っています。私は並べ替えとフィルタリングに関する2つの質問があります。Nebula NatTableのソートとフィルタリングに関する質問

  1. filter exampleソートおよびフィルタリングのために与えられた別の実施例、sort exampleがあります。私の質問は、 これらの機能をNatTableの1つのインスタンスに含めることができますか?

  2. NatTableインスタンスが になった後で、filterheaderコントロールを削除できますか?はいの場合、どうすればいいですか?

+1

最初の質問については、確かに実行できます。 [Everything_but_the_kitchen_sink](https://github.com/eclipse/nebula.widgets.nattable/blob/master/org.eclipse.nebula.widgets.nattable.examples/src/org/eclipse/nebula/widgets/nattable/)を参照してください。 examples/examples/_900_Everything_but_the_kitchen_sink.java)の例です。 –

+0

ありがとうございます。私は例を確認します – ssdimmanuel

答えて

1
  1. はいとそれを示すいくつかの例があります。それらの一部は、たとえばチュートリアル例 - 統合にあります。 NatTableのすべての機能を組み合わせることができます。

  2. フィルターヘッダー行は特別な制御がないので、あなたはそれを意味すると思います。後で層スタックから除去することはできません。しかし、可視性は実行時に変更することができます。デフォルトでは、キーバインドさえ有効になっています。 F3キーを押すと、実行時に表示を切り替えることができます。問題は、なぜ、作成時間の後にフィルター行を削除したいのですか?通常、プログラムでフィルタリングするには、フィルタ行を使用せずにフィルタ行を使用する必要があります。FilterList

+0

あなたの答えをありがとう。私はサンプルをチェックし、自分のアプリケーションと統合することができました。そして、はい、私はフィルタ行の可視性を意味します(削除ではありません)。 F3は魔法のように機能します。クール!! – ssdimmanuel